Chelonus inanitus (L.) is an egg-larval parasitoid of noctuids Spodoptera exigua (Hübner) and S. littoralis (Boisduval), whose mass rearing or real potential has not been targeted yet. To improve the rearing in the factitious host Ephestia kuehniella Zeller, we investigated the influence of host age and number of females parasitizing simultaneously on the overall rearing success, the influence of host age on the life cycle, and the influence of host species on the parasitoid body size. The proportion of emerging C. inanitus was higher from young host eggs, but more females emerged from mature eggs. Under high parasitoid competition, we observed a reduction in non-parasitized hosts without reducing parasitoid emergence. The parasitoid life cycle was longer in females, but the mismatch between sexes was smaller in mature eggs. The parasitoid size was smaller in the factitious host than in the natural hosts. Under semi-field conditions, we investigated the competition among parasitoid females on the overall parasitism success. The reproductive parasitism was more successful in S. exigua than in S. littoralis, and the maximum emergence was reached with three and four females, respectively. The control of S. littoralis may be attributed to the high developmental mortality, a non-reproductive parasitism that is often underestimated.

Greater internet penetration and ecommerce has led to demand for personalized product development and faster fulfilment. This has increased global competition wherein the manufacturer and retailers not only have to deal with an unprecedented number and variety of products but also makes forecasting and scheduling difficult. To address these problems, rapid response logistics has become a necessity. The current study discusses the role of such rapid response systems and various implementation strategies in both the demand and supply side of supply chains that can be the solutions to the dynamic business environment. It discusses the information sharing technologies based on different level of sophistication which are used by the different echeloned supply chains. The paper reviews the important literature in these aspects and brings forth the challenges of the rapid response systems and the new directions of research which needs to be undertaken to gauge the real potential of rapid response systems.

The research aimed to analyze the suitability of local tax target setting with real potential, analyze strategies and factors that influence the optimization of the advertisement tax performance, swallow's nest tax, groundwater tax, and Non-Metal Mineral Tax in Pekanbaru City. The object of this study is the Pekanbaru City Regional Revenue Agency and four objects/subjects of local taxes studied in Pekanbaru City. The method used is qualitative with a case study approach. This research shows that the target setting of Advertising Tax, Swallow's Nest Tax, Groundwater Tax, and Non-Metal Mineral and Rock Tax has not been adjusted to the real potential. The performance reports of each Regional Tax studied were inadequate in relation to the strategies implemented, which made it difficult for the Regional Revenue Agency to make effective and efficient decisions. The factors that influence tax optimization are the inadequate organizational structure, updating of the taxation database, human resources, the use of information technology, strengthening regulations, and supporting infrastructure.Keywords: Local Tax; Target; Strategy; Constraints. AbstrakPenelitian bertujuan untuk menganalisis kesesuaian penetapan target pajak daerah dengan potensi ril, menganalisis strategi dan faktor-faktor yang mempengaruhi optimalisasi kinerja Pajak Reklame, Pajak Sarang Burung Walet, Pajak Air Tanah; dan Pajak  Mineral Bukan Logam di Kota Pekanbaru. AbstractNumerous approaches have been proposed to overcome the intrinsically low selectivity of surface-enhanced Raman spectroscopy (SERS), and the modification of SERS substrates with diverse recognition molecules is one of such approaches. In contrast to the use of antibodies, aptamers, and molecularly imprinted polymers, application of cyclodextrins (CDs) is still developing with less than 100 papers since 1993. Therefore, the main goal of this review is the critical analysis of all available papers on the use of CDs in SERS analysis, including physicochemical studies of CD complexation and the effect of CD presence on the Raman enhancement. The results of the review reveal that there is controversial information about CD efficiency and further experimental investigations have to be done in order to estimate the real potential of CDs in SERS-based analysis. Autism spectrum disorder (ASD) is a neurodevelopmental disorder, where social and communication deficits and repetitive behaviors are present. Plant-derived bioactives have shown promising results in the treatment of autism. In this sense, this review is aimed at providing a careful view on the use of plant-derived bioactive molecules for the treatment of autism. Among the plethora of bioactives, curcumin, luteolin, and resveratrol have revealed excellent neuroprotective effects and can be effectively used in the treatment of neuropsychological disorders. However, the number of clinical trials is limited, and none of them have been approved for the treatment of autism or autism-related disorder. Further clinical studies are needed to effectively assess the real potential of such bioactive molecules.

Despite the best efforts of programmers to create high-quality software, some errors inevitably escape even the most rigorous testing process and are first encountered by end users of the software. When this happens, developers need to quickly understand the reasons for the errors that occurred and eliminate them. Back in 1951, at the dawn of modern computing, Stanley Gill wrote that special attention should be paid to those errors that occur after the program is started, and lead to its termination. Gill is considered the founder of the so-called postmortem debugging, when a program or system is modified to record its state at the time of failure, so that the programmer can later understand what happened and why such a situation occurred. Since then, postmortem debugging technology has been used in many different systems, including all major general-purpose operating systems (OS), as well as specialized OS such as embedded systems and real-time systems. To ensure the high level of reliability expected from such critical systems, it is necessary, on the one hand, to implement the possibility of rapid recovery of the system or its part after a failure. On the other hand, it is necessary to provide a mechanism for storing as much information as possible after each failure, so that the cause of its occurrence can be determined later. To understand the real potential of postmortem debugging tools, we will first consider the current state of debugging methods and the role of postmortem analysis tools, as well as the requirements for postmortem debugging tools for critical systems. Next, we will describe the mechanism of postmortem debugging implemented by the authors in the RTOS Baget and formulate tasks for further development.

AbstractAn outlook on the current status of different strategies for magnetic micro- and nanosized bead functionalization with aptamers as prominent bioreceptors is given with a focus on electrochemical and optical apta-assays, as well as on aptamer-modified magnetic bead–based miniaturized extraction techniques in food control. Critical aspects that affect interaction of aptamers with target molecules, as well as the possible side effects caused by aptamer interaction with other molecules due to non-specific binding, are discussed. Challenges concerning the real potential and limitations of aptamers as bioreceptors when facing analytical problems in food control are addressed. Graphical abstract

The intensive use of digital platforms by the feminist movement has been identified as one of its main characteristics. Numerous studies address the tactical use of social networks by this movement, especially on 8 March in Spain. This paper studies the action repertoires of different actors who participated in the 2019 Women’s Strike conversation, including automated accounts. Empirical results demonstrate that Twitter is not an exclusive field for the feminist movement. Along with activists who promoted and informed the Women’s Strike, political parties proposed concrete policy measures, and conservative factions criticized the movement calling for demobilization. In this sense, for the first time in these M8 mobilizations, bots participated in this polarisation of the debate through partisan hashtags and the dissemination of fake news. The investigation thus confirms that automation techniques and contradictory flows of power are critical elements to understand the real potential of social networks for feminist social change.

Distance / e-learning has real potential to stimulate the development of gifted and talented students. Even if it is not planned, organized and conducted in a format that allows them to manage learning that is relatively independent of the main flow ( main stream students), to enable students to individual control during work, methods for learning and organization of free time. The article raises the question of how distance learning, introduced in an emergency situation, has affected gifted and talented students. The answers are sought through the analysis of a survey conducted with teachers, gifted students and their parents. The different points of view lead to the conclusion that when developing a long – term strategy for working with talented students at school, the opinions and reactions of all participants in the learning process should be thoroughly studied.
